Stakeholder Relations

This year the NEF accompanied or hosted the following delegations at the invitation of the respective stakeholders as an expert-source on the implementation of BB-BEE:

• the Presidential delegation to Qatar,
• the Deputy Presidential delegation to Turkey,
• the dti’s delegation to Switzerland and the UK, and
• the African Investor (AI) Summit delegation to the New York Stock Exchange NYSE.

Two presentations were made to Parliament this year. The Strategic Plan was presented in March 2008 and the Annual Report was presented to the Portfolio Committee on Trade and Industry in November 2008, as part of the dti joint presentation. Input was made into the dti presentation to the NCOP Select Committee on Economics and Foreign Affairs for January 2009.

Of the 31 presentations and exhibitions prepared during the year, several were made as part of and in support of the dti agency programme.

Over the year under review the NEF further grew in stature as a DFI with a distinct voice and as a source of reference to other DFIs servicing the South African market. This view became progressively more apparent in the references to the NEF in the media. The NEF has in turn been called upon by the dti and the other dominant DFIs to express its view on matters relating to the DFI landscape with special emphasis on the policy supporting its overall mandate, namely BB-BEE.
